British eco sex toy brand Love Not War has explained how they all of their vibrators in a custom built, green powered factory using recycled drink cans, with four 330ml cans providing enough aluminium to produce one toy. Speaking for National Recycling Week, Will Ranscombe, co-founder, said it also takes just one recycled daily newspaper (120g roughly) to produce enough eco-friendly cardboard to package two Love Not War units. Will and his co-founder Rob Scott set out to create the world's first product range of vibrators that is eco-conscious. Will said: “From day one, sustainability has been right at the centre of the brand. All the products come in two parts, meaning that the base is interchangeable and the toys are more easily repairable.
